Watch New Hampshire vs. Rhode Island Live: CAA Football Showdown

In this weekend's CAA showdown, Rhode Island will face New Hampshire in Durham on Oct. 19. The Rams (5-1) have a strong conference record at 2-0 and recently defeated Brown 31-21. Standout running back Malik Grant scored five touchdowns in the last three games, while quarterback Devin Farrell amassed over 200 passing yards in the same game. The Wildcats (4-2) also hold an undefeated record in conference play and ended their three-game winning streak against Elon with a 17-10 win. New Hampshire leads the all-time series 17-6 and will look to defend its home opener against the Rams, who are looking for their first road win in the rivalry.

Through the numbers

  • Rhode Island's record: 5-1, with a 2-0 conference mark.
  • New Hampshire's record: 4-2, also undefeated in CAA play.

Yes but

While New Hampshire holds a dominant lead in the series, recent meetings have been closely contested, with Rhode Island winning its last meeting in overtime in 2023. The historical context adds pressure for both teams, especially the Rams, who have never won on the road in New Hampshire.

state of affairs

  • Kickoff is scheduled for Saturday, October 19th at 1:00 p.m. ET.
  • The game will take place at Wildcat Stadium, which has a capacity of 11,015 spectators.
